Operating Environment
The accessory is intended for indoor use and should be operated in a clean, dry environment. Before using this product, ensure that its operating environment is maintained within these parameters:
Temperature: 0 to 40° C
Humidity: Maximum relative humidity 80 % for temperatures up to 31 °C
decreasing linearly to 50 % relative humidity at 40° C
Altitude: Up to 10,000 ft (3,048 m)
Introduction
The ZS Series (ZS1000, ZS1500, and ZS2500) are a small, high-impedance active probes designed to meet today’s increasing demand for measurements on a variety of test points. With low input capacitance and high input resistance, circuit loading is minimized.
The ZS probes can be used with a variety of Teledyne LeCroy oscilloscopes with MAUI firmware version 6.5.0.5 or later (see the product page at teledynelecroy.com/oscilloscope for compatibility). With the ProBus interface, the probe becomes an integral part of the oscilloscope, controlled from the oscilloscope’s front panel. The oscilloscope provides power to the probe, so there is no need for a separate power supply or batteries.
See the ZS product page at teledynelecroy.com for probe specifications.

Tips
Straight Tip
The straight tip is rugged and designed for general probing. Fits in either probe socket.
IC Lead Tip
The IC Lead Tip is covered in insulation on all si
des (except for a small edge). This tip was
designed to prevent shorting neighboring IC leads. The gold part of the tip is not insulated and should touch the IC lead to be tested. It is one
-
size
-fits-all and will work with any IC lead pitch.
Fits in either probe socket.
Bent Tip
The Bent Tip is made out of titanium, this tip is ideal for situations that require
you to hold the
probe parallel to the circuit board under test. Also gives you more control when holding the probe like a pencil. Fits in either probe socket.
Pogo Tip
The pogo tip provides z-axis compliance. The tip can fit into a socket or onto a
n IC leg.
Discrete SMD Tip
The crescent shape of this tip is designed to fit tightly on capacitors, resistors, transistors and other surface mount components with discrete leads. Fits in either probe socket
.
2.54mm Square Pin Adapter
2.54 mm Square Pin Adapter. The 2.54 mm square pin adapter fits into both the
input and
ground lead of the ZS probe for easy connection to standard 2.54 mm square pin spacing on a circuit board.

Grounds
Offset Ground
The Offset Ground is designed to be attached to either socket of the probe head. The
Offset
Ground
connects to the ground socket and wraps
around the probe head
, making it possible to
probe a
signal and ground that are extremely
close together. The short length provides
the
high
est quality grounding for high frequency
applications.
Narrow Ground Blade and Copper Pad
The Narrow Ground Blade and Copper Pad together are
the best grounding solution for
probing an IC. The
Narrow Ground Blade is
designed to provide a short, low inductance ground path. The Copper Pad is adhesive backed to stick to the top of an
IC, and can then be
soldered to the IC ground.
Wide Ground Blade
The Wide Ground Blade is ideal for use when the best quality ground is needed. The wide blade offers the minimal inductance compared to the narrow ground blade.
